Like its palatial contemporaries Biltmore and San Simeon, Vizcaya represents an achievement of the Gilded Age, when country houses and their gardens were a conspicuous measure of personal wealth and power. In Vizcaya, the authors use illustrations, historic photographs, and narrative to document this extraordinary house and landscape.

Examines the processes of disappearance during the late 16th and 17th centuries--through assimilation or extermination--of the native Indians encountered by Spaniards in present-day Chihuahua, Mexico.

The FAO regional project “Development of effective and inclusive food value chains in ASEAN Member States” (GCP/RAS/296/JPN) aimed to make a significant contribution to the food and livelihood security of smallholders, who will be integrated into food value chains and linked to new market opportunities. The Ginger Value Chain Study report provides an overview and analysis of the ginger industry in Nueva Vizcaya in the Philippines, with the aim of identifying main leverage points and key strategies to improve its competitiveness. The report provides the basis for the formulation of the project’s future activities, and lays the foundation for the project’s cooperation with the private sector and other government agencies active in the ginger industry.
